
Alfalfa - SA Standard
Alfalfa is prized for its high protein content and rich supply of vitamins and minerals. Alfalfa sprouts are known for their antioxidant properties and support in digestion and heart health. They are also rich in protein, vitamins A, C, E, and K, and minerals like calcium, potassium, and iron.
-
HIGH PROTEIN CONTENT— Alfalfa is rich in protein, providing all essential amino acids, making it a valuable source for muscle repair, growth, and overall body function, especially in plant-based diets.
-
RICH IN VITAMINS— contains high levels of vitamins A, C, E, and K. Vitamin A supports vision and immune health, vitamin C acts as a potent antioxidant, vitamin E protects cells from oxidative damage, and vitamin K is crucial for blood clotting and bone health.
-
ESSENTIAL MINERALS— loaded with important minerals such as calcium, iron, magnesium, and potassium. Calcium and magnesium support bone health, iron aids in oxygen transport, and potassium helps regulate fluid balance and nerve signals.
-
LOW IN CALORIES— Alfalfa is low in calories yet nutrient-dense, making it an excellent addition to diets focused on weight management and overall health without adding excessive calories.
-
HIGH IN ANTIOXIDANTS— packed with antioxidants like flavonoids and saponins, which help protect cells from oxidative stress, reduce inflammation, and lower the risk of chronic diseases.
-
DIETARY FIBER— a good source of dietary fiber, promoting healthy digestion, supporting gut health, and aiding in the regulation of blood sugar levels.
-
DETOXIFYING PROPERTIES— rich in chlorophyll, which may help detoxify the body, improve blood oxygen levels, and provide potential anti-inflammatory and antioxidant effects.
-
HEART HEALTH SUPPORT— contains compounds that may help lower cholesterol levels and support cardiovascular health, reducing the risk of heart disease.
-
HORMONE BALANCE— Alfalfa contains phytoestrogens, which may help in balancing hormones and providing relief from menopausal symptoms.

To grow alfalfa sprouts:
- SOAK — for 8-12 hours in cool water to start the sprouting process.
- RINSE / DRAIN— 2-3 times per day thoroughly to promote seed growth.
- HARVEST— after 5-7 days. Or grow your sprouts to your preferred taste! You can taste them at each rinse to find your ideal harvest time.
To grow alfalfa micro-greens:
- PLANT— your seeds can be planted right away!
- HARVEST— after 10-14 days. Or grow your micro-greens to your preferred taste!
